West Virginia Governor Jim Justice Enters Senate Race Against Democrat Joe Manchin.

TL;DR Summary
West Virginia Governor Jim Justice, a Republican, has filed paperwork to run for the US Senate seat currently held by incumbent Democratic Senator Joe Manchin. Manchin's seat is considered one of the most winnable for Republicans in next year's election, and if he decides not to run for a third term, Democrats are widely expected to lose the seat to whichever Republican nominee emerges from West Virginia's Senate primary. Justice, who switched parties in 2017 and has since become one of the red state's most popular politicians, is set to announce his campaign at his luxury hotel in White Sulphur Springs, West Virginia.
